Tennis Lions Close Season With Win Over Frisch

by Ezra Wildes ('17) The MTA Tennis Lions took the court on Thursday night at the Althea Gibson Tennis Center in Newark, NJ, hoping to end their season on a high note with a win over Frisch. MTA grabbed the early lead thanks to a dominant performance from #1 Singles Star Josh Zyskynd ('17), who with a relentless dose of blistering serves and whipping forehands, overwhelmed his opponent en route to a 10-0 victory. The #1 Doubles Team of Chanina Rothenberg ('17) and Yedidya Schechter ('19) followed suit, outlasting their opponents in what were some hard-fought games, including an epic, half-hour, 15-deuce game to take an early 3-0 lead. The opposition never recovered after that game and MTA cruised to a 10-1 victory. Frisch, however, battled back, taking the next two matches in #3 Singles and #2 Doubles, thereby knotting the match at 2 games apiece. That left the fate of the match in the hands of #2 Singles veteran Ezra Wildes ('17) who was locked in a tight contest. After 18 games the score was squared at 9 games all, forcing a "win by 2" scenario. With ice in his veins and timely shot-making, Ezra craftily struck well-placed backhands in the next 2 games propelling him to a 11-9 personal victory, handing MTA the big win. "This was truly a night to remember. I can't ask for a better way to end our season!" commented Coach Eli Gewirtz ('07). MTA celebrated their victory and a successful season at Dougie's BBQ in Teaneck after the match.
